Interventions
BEHAVIORAL

RAMP PrEP initiation, adherence, and retention intervention

The intervention arm will receive facilitated strengths-based case management (SBCM)-delivered by trained interventionists-to help navigate the PrEP medical care system and support the participant and health care staff in meeting the challenges faced with obtaining PrEP medication (e.g., overcoming insurance barriers or barriers with co-pays). This also includes facilitated integration into the PrEP clinic and obtaining monthly PrEP prescription refills.
